What Is Actually Happening with Qatar Airways Right Now

On February 28, 2026, US and Israeli forces launched military strikes on Iranian targets. Iran responded with ballistic missiles and drones targeting Israel and several Gulf states. Qatar, the UAE, Saudi Arabia, Kuwait, and Bahrain all faced airspace disruptions in the days that followed. Smoke was reported in Doha's industrial district on March 1. A drone struck near Dubai Airport Terminal 3 on March 7. A fuel depot was hit on March 16. The conflict remains active with no ceasefire in place as of late March 2026.

Qatar Airways was the hardest hit of the three major Gulf carriers. The airline suspended all flights on February 28, began limited relief operations from Muscat and Riyadh on March 5, and has been gradually restoring Doha departures since. Several aircraft have been placed in storage, which signals that management does not expect a fast return to normal.

The current waiver applies to all passengers with bookings dated between February 28 and April 30, 2026. Two options are available:

  • Free rebooking onto any Qatar Airways-operated flight with new travel through May 31, 2026. Two date changes are permitted at no charge.
  • A full refund of the unused ticket value, with no cancellation penalty, including on non-refundable Economy Lite fares.

No-show fees have been waived for passengers who could not board due to the crisis. Passengers who booked through a travel agent must go through their agent or the Qatar Airways Trade Portal for changes. Self-service rebooking is available through Manage Booking at qatarairways.com.

For context on how Qatar compares to the other Gulf carriers right now: Emirates has recovered to roughly 60 to 80 percent of normal capacity. Etihad is operating at around 50 percent. Qatar Airways is at approximately 20 percent. Qatar's peninsular geography limits how easily the airline can re-route around closed airspace, which partly explains the slower recovery.

Critical Scam Warning: Read This Before You Search for a Number

Qatar Airways and Hamad International Airport have issued a joint fraud alert following a significant spike in impersonation attempts during the crisis. This is not a routine warning. Scammers are specifically targeting stranded and frustrated passengers.

The most dangerous tactic right now is fake phone numbers appearing in Google search results and Google Ads. This is a well-documented industry-wide problem: scammers place paid search ads so that fake call center numbers appear above the real airline's own website in results. Passengers who call are connected to operators posing as Qatar Airways agents who create urgency, ask for booking references, and then request credit card details for a supposed processing or rebooking fee. Do not search Google for Qatar Airways phone numbers. Only use numbers from this article or from qatarairways.com directly.

Other active scam types during this period include fake social media accounts that monitor public posts where passengers tag the airline, then reply with "help" offers to harvest personal information. There are also phishing emails mimicking Qatar Airways vendor communications, fake lottery notifications (Qatar Airways does not run lotteries), fake recruitment offers requiring upfront payment, and lookalike websites with slightly misspelled domain names.

Qatar Airways will never ask for passwords, OTPs, banking details, or credit card information via social media or direct messages. Verified official channels: @QatarAirways and @QRsupport on X (both gold-checked), the WhatsApp number +974 3131 1164 (blue verification badge), and email from @qatarairways.com.qa or @qr.qatarairways.com domains only.

If you suspect you have already been targeted, stop all communication, do not send further information, and contact your bank immediately if any payment details were shared. Report suspicious contacts at qatarairways.com/en/fraud-report.html.

Your Passenger Rights During the Qatar Airways Disruption

What you are owed beyond Qatar Airways' voluntary waiver depends on where your disrupted flight was departing from.

Departing from an EU airport: EU Regulation EC 261/2004 applies. Qatar Airways must offer a full refund within seven days or re-routing at the earliest opportunity, plus duty of care (meals, hotel, transport) for the duration of the delay. The cash compensation of 250 to 600 euros for cancellations very likely does not apply here because military conflict and airspace closure constitute "extraordinary circumstances" under EU law. The duty of care obligation has no time limit, so if you were stranded in an EU airport for multiple days, accommodation and meal expenses are claimable even in extraordinary circumstances.

Departing from a UK airport: UK261 mirrors the EU framework. Compensation in pounds (220 to 520). Same extraordinary circumstances exemption on cash compensation. You have six years to file claims. The UK CAA handles complaints.

Departing from a US airport: US DOT rules that took effect in October 2024 require Qatar Airways to issue cash refunds within seven business days for credit card payments when a flight is cancelled and you decline rebooking. Crucially, US rules apply regardless of cause. Even force majeure does not let the airline off the hook for a refund. The airline must proactively tell you about your refund options before offering a voucher or alternative.

Departing from India: Full refund or alternate flight is required. Force majeure removes the compensation obligation but not the refund obligation.

Departing from Australia: No EU261 equivalent exists. Your rights come from Australian Consumer Law and the Montreal Convention, which covers provable financial losses from delay up to approximately 5,400 euros but allows airlines to use force majeure as a defence. Travel insurance becomes critical here.

One important insurance warning: many travel insurance policies contain war and conflict exclusions. Government travel advisories against travel to affected regions may also invalidate coverage. Check your policy wording now if you have travel coming up in the region.

Call Tips: How to Get Through and Make It Count

  • Call before 8am local time. Queue length builds throughout the day as disrupted passengers across time zones wake up. First hour of opening is consistently the shortest wait.
  • Have everything in front of you before you dial. Booking reference, full name as it appears on the ticket, travel dates, and what you want: rebook or refund. Knowing your preferred new dates before you call means the agent can move in one conversation.
  • Travel agent bookings require a different call. If your ticket was issued by a travel agent, Qatar Airways cannot process changes directly. Call your agent first. This is the single most common reason calls fail to resolve anything.
  • Use two channels simultaneously. Open a WhatsApp conversation or send a DM to @QRsupport while you wait on hold. Whichever responds first wins.
  • Ask for a case reference number. Write it down before you hang up. If you need to follow up, this number means you do not start from scratch.
  • Do not accept a voucher if you want a refund. Under US DOT rules and EU261, you are entitled to cash. You do not have to accept travel credit or a voucher. Politely decline the alternative and ask specifically for a refund.
